Flower Characteristics

Description of Flower Colors and Structure 🌸

The Mutsu Apple boasts stunning flowers that range from white to a delicate pink. Their strong fragrance is not just delightful; it plays a crucial role in attracting pollinators.

These flowers are large and cup-shaped, featuring five distinct petals. Typically, they bloom in clusters, creating a beautiful display that enhances any garden.

The visual appeal of Mutsu Apple flowers is matched by their aromatic qualities, making them a favorite among both gardeners and bees. This combination of color and scent is essential for successful pollination and fruit development.

Blooming Process

Blooming Stages and Typical Bloom Time 🌸

The blooming process of the Mutsu Apple unfolds in distinct stages: bud formation, flowering, and fruit set. Each stage is crucial for ensuring a successful harvest.

Typically, Mutsu Apple trees bloom in late spring, around May. This timing aligns with warmer weather, which encourages growth and pollination.

From the moment buds form, it takes approximately 2-3 weeks for the flowers to reach full bloom. During this period, the anticipation builds as the buds swell and prepare to burst open.

Once in bloom, the flowers usually last for about one week. This brief window is vital for pollination and subsequent fruit development.

Pollination Methods

Natural Pollination 🐝

Mutsu apples thrive on the natural pollination provided by bees and other insects. These pollinators play a crucial role in transferring pollen from one flower to another, ensuring a robust fruit set.

Manual Pollination Techniques 🎨

For gardeners looking to boost their Mutsu apple's fruit production, manual pollination can be a game-changer. Here’s how to do it effectively:

  1. Timing is Key: Pollinate during the morning when flowers are fully open and receptive.
  2. Use a Brush: Gently collect pollen from a flower using a small paintbrush or cotton swab.
  3. Transfer Pollen: Carefully apply the pollen to the stigma of another flower, ensuring good contact.

Enhancing Fruit Set 🍏

Manual pollination can significantly enhance fruit set, especially in areas with fewer natural pollinators. This technique is especially useful if you're growing Mutsu apples in a less populated area or if the weather conditions are not favorable for bees.

Unique Aspects of Mutsu Apple Flowering

🌼 Variations in Flowering

The flowering of Mutsu apples can significantly vary based on environmental conditions and care practices. Factors like temperature, humidity, and sunlight exposure play crucial roles in determining how well these trees bloom.

For instance, a warm spring can lead to an earlier bloom, while cooler temperatures may delay the process. Additionally, trees that receive adequate sunlight and are well-watered tend to produce more flowers, enhancing the potential for fruit development.

πŸ“œ Historical Context

Understanding the historical context of the Mutsu apple adds depth to its flowering characteristics. Developed in Japan in the 1930s, this apple is a hybrid of the Golden Delicious and the Indo apple.

This hybrid nature contributes to its unique flowering traits, making it adaptable to various climates. The Mutsu apple's rich history not only informs its growth patterns but also its resilience, allowing it to thrive in diverse environments.
